Title:
GAME PLAYING MACHINE
Document Type and Number:
WIPO Patent Application WO/2006/054621
Kind Code:
A1
Abstract:
A game playing machine reliably preventing the draw result from being predicted and a false play of aiming at a specific draw result using a sensory device. Random number generating means (70) sequentially generates numeric information in a predetermined range and acquires and holds the numeric information at a predetermined timing as a random number. A CPU (113) acquires the random number through altering means (80) and stores it in a RAM (112). The altering means (80) interchanges the number of order of at least two signals in each of upper- and lower-order signal sequences of a bit sequence of the random number held in the random number generating means (70) so as to alter the content of the random number. Drawing means (114) of the CPU (113) performs drawing of judging whether the random number altered by the altering means (80) is a predetermined winning number or a predetermined blank number. The CPU (113) controls the game content according to the draw result by the drawing means (114).
